The gym I go to is strictly Muay Thai. The best thing for you to do in order to get ready for MT training is to run. If you have a heavy bag I recommend doing punches and kicks to it but only for cardio because how ever you kick or punch will probably be refined through your training and you don't want to have to unlearn an improper kick that you've thrown hundreds of times. Get use to 3-5 minute rounds of punching the heavy bag and then rest 1 min inbetween. But most importantly run around 2-5 miles a day if you ever plan on fighting. I'm a huge believer that the #1 thing that decides who wins and who looses in a fight is who is tired and who isn't. push ups/pull ups and sit ups do about 100 a day (40 pull ups a day)
